HamburgerMenu
hirist

Job Description

Description :

Job Summary :


We are looking for an experienced Database Team Lead to oversee the design, administration, performance, and security of enterprise databases.

The ideal candidate will combine strong hands-on database expertise with proven leadership skills to guide a team of DBAs and database engineers while ensuring high availability, scalability, and data integrity across critical systems.

Key Responsibilities :


Database Leadership & Team Management :


- Lead, mentor, and manage a team of database administrators and engineers.

- Allocate tasks, set priorities, and ensure timely delivery of database-related initiatives.

- Establish database standards, best practices, and operational procedures.

- Conduct performance reviews, knowledge-sharing sessions, and technical mentoring.

Database Design & Architecture :


- Design and implement scalable, secure, and high-performance database architectures.

- Review and optimize data models, schemas, indexing strategies, and queries.

- Support application teams in database design, migrations, and enhancements.

- Ensure alignment with enterprise architecture and business requirements.

Database Administration & Operations :


- Manage installation, configuration, upgrades, and patching of database systems.

- Ensure database availability, reliability, and disaster recovery readiness.

- Monitor database health, capacity, and performance proactively.

- Perform root cause analysis and resolution of database-related incidents.

Performance, Security & Compliance :


- Tune queries, stored procedures, and database configurations for optimal performance.

- Implement database security, access control, encryption, and auditing mechanisms.

- Ensure compliance with data governance, regulatory, and security standards.

- Manage backup, recovery, and business continuity strategies.

Collaboration & Stakeholder Management :


- Work closely with application development, DevOps, infrastructure, and security teams.

- Communicate database risks, performance metrics, and improvement plans to stakeholders.

- Support production releases, deployments, and on-call rotations as needed.

Required Skills & Qualifications :


Technical Skills (Mandatory) :


- 8+ years of experience in database administration and management.


- Strong expertise in RDBMS such as Oracle, MySQL, PostgreSQL, SQL Server.


- Hands-on experience with database performance tuning and optimization.

- Strong knowledge of SQL, PL/SQL, T-SQL, or equivalent scripting languages.

- Experience with backup, recovery, replication, and high availability solutions.

Good to Have / Preferred Skills :


- Experience with NoSQL databases (MongoDB, Cassandra, Redis).

- Exposure to cloud databases (AWS RDS/Aurora, Azure SQL, GCP Cloud SQL).

- Knowledge of data migration tools and strategies.

- Familiarity with DevOps, CI/CD pipelines, and database automation.

- Experience with monitoring tools such as Prometheus, Grafana, OEM, or SolarWinds.

Leadership & Soft Skills :


- Proven ability to lead and motivate technical teams.

- Strong problem-solving and decision-making skills.

- Excellent communication and stakeholder management abilities.

- Ability to manage multiple priorities in high-pressure environments.

- Strong analytical and documentation skills.

Educational Qualification :


- Bachelors or Masters degree in Computer Science, Information Technology, Engineering, or related field.

- Relevant certifications (Oracle DBA, Microsoft SQL Server, AWS/Azure Database certifications) are a plus


info-icon

Did you find something suspicious?

Similar jobs that you might be interested in